Your still using the same Brembo calipers where the clamping force is generated, just swapping the rotors for ones that are pre-drilled. You loose some small percentage of surface area due to the holes, so that is a consideration. But I would think that is likely to be imperceptible to most drivers. And the drilled rotors do look nice! Lots of people using the Z26 pads, myself included. I don't think you would notice the difference in the pads other then the no dust.

If it were me, I would go with the PowerStop kit.
